Mumbai: Lab-grown diamond jewellery brand beYon, from the House of Titan, had a grand celebration on June 3, 2026, to mark its official launch, following the opening of its first exclusive retail store in Mumbai on December 29, 2025.
Titan had long resisted lab-grown diamonds, and even now it is selling them only at a single, dedicated beYon store and online, rather than at any of its 760 Tanishq, Mia, Zoya, and CaratLane outlets. The company is targeting Gen Z and millennials with beYon, and considers it as a bridge to draw them to future purchase of natural diamonds.
The event introduced beYon through an experience-led evening that included a mandala performance and an interactive installation. The brand positioned adornment as an instinct that predates occasion and convention, framing its offering around everyday wear.

The guest list included actors Neha Dhupia, Shweta Tripathi and Krystle D’Souza, along with several editors, creators, stylists, business leaders and other cultural voices from the city.
A key moment of the evening was a live performance by movement artist Zia Nath, who presented the whirling mandala. The performance aligned with the brand’s intent to build engagement around laboratory-grown diamonds.
The venue also featured a laboratory-grown diamond discovery zone, where guests were introduced to the process and craftsmanship behind the stones. The display included collections across categories such as earrings, rings, pendants, necklaces, bracelets, bangles and nosepins. A lapidary unit demonstration showed artisans shaping diamonds.

The brand name combines ‘be’ and ‘Yon’, with the latter referring to a term meaning beyond. The brand offers more than 1,250 designs, with over 800 available in-store across product categories.
